Understanding AWS Cloud Costs for Oracle Workloads
Migrating business workloads to the AWS cloud can bring numerous benefits, but it's crucial to understand the potential costs involved. Oracle databases are frequently used in mission-critical applications, and their migration to AWS requires careful planning to reduce expenses.
One key factor is determining the right AWS solution for your Oracle workload. Different options like Amazon EC2, RDS for Oracle, or Oracle Cloud Infrastructure (OCI) have varying pricing structures.
Analyze factors such as compute needs, storage volume, and network throughput. Additionally, adopting cost-optimization strategies like Reserved Resources or Spot Instances can substantially lower your overall cloud spending.
Regularly tracking your AWS costs and tweaking your infrastructure as needed is essential for maintaining spending control.
